ID:37837 

M. F. from Wokingham

Saturday 5 May 2018 (7 years ago)

Area:Lugg & Arrow

Beat:Arrow Titley

Fishing:Trout (River)

No. of Anglers:1

The river on this beat is in good order. Nothing rising so all four fish caught were taken on either a PTN or a hare's ear nymph suspended below a dry fly. The largest fish was 9 1/2" long. A number of other (probably larger) fish were hooked and lost, so the tally could have been greater had the angler been in better form.

4 Trout
